The Naval Surface Warfare Center, Indian Head Division (NSWCIHD) has a requirement for an Amplifier, Signal Conditioner, and Digitizing Instrument per the attached salient characteristics. A combined synopsis/solicitation for commercial items is hereby being issued in accordance with the format in Federal Acquisition Regulations (FAR) Subpart 12.6, as supplemented with additional information included in this notice. Quotes are being requested. This announcement N00174-13-T-0033 constitutes the only written Request for Quote (RFQ), unless amended. This solicitation document and incorporated provisions and clauses are those in effect through the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R), and Federal Acquisition Circular (FAC) 2005-58 and the Defense Federal Acquisition Regulation Supplement (DFARS) Publication Notice 20120529. This acquisition is 100% set aside for small business in accordance with DFAR 252.211-7003 SMALL BUSINESS SET ASIDE, FAR 52.219-1 AND FAR 52.219-6 (THIS MEANS YOU MUST BE SMALL BUSINESS, QUOTING THE PRODUCT OF A SMALL BUSINESS MANUFACTURER). The NAICS code is 334517. The size standard is 500 employees. The FSC code is 6635. The Government will award a contract resulting from this solicitation to the responsible offeror whose offer conforming to the solicitation; will be the lowest price technically acceptable offer with acceptable past performance. The following factors will be used to evaluate offers: (1) Technical Capability of the items and services offered to meet the minimum needs of the Government based on examination of either product literature or technical approach narrative, or both; (2) Past Performance (see FAR 52.212-1(b)(10)); and (3) Price. The Offeror shall describe, in detail, how it will meet the requirements of the specification for the Amplifier, Signal Conditioner, and Digitizing Instrument. General statements, that the Offeror can or will comply with the requirements, that standard procedures will be used, that well known techniques will be used, or that paraphrases the RFP's specification in whole or in part, will not constitute compliance with the mandatory requirements concerning the content of the Technical proposal.
